"From his new home in the 'lush perch' of nearby Petropolis, the emigre Viennese bestseller relished the warmth, grace and tolerance of Brazil's 'new kind of civilisation', with its blessed absence of racism. Meanwhile, in the Nazi-occupied Europe that the literary superstar had fled, total war had reached its deep midnight. With his younger second wife Lotte Altmann chronically ill, his peers scattered and the 'posthumous existence' of the exile closing in, his depression deepened. A few days later, he took a fatal dose of barbiturate; Lotte followed him. Although their double suicide seemed to ratify Goebbels' grim jest about artistic emigres as 'cadavers on leave', the shock stiffened the resolve of Zweig's many friends in the anti-Hitler diaspora. The New York Times ran a heartfelt editorial: not the refugees but the Nazis, it said, were the real exiles from civilisation, 'branded with the mark of Cain'. By the end of 1942, after El Alamein and Stalingrad, a faint daybreak began. Zweig would never see that dawn. Thoughtful, evocative and quietly gripping, George Prochnik's book about Zweig's exemplary exile does not offer a cradle-to-grave biography. Oliver Matuschek, whom he fully credits, did that job superbly in 2011. Rather, The Impossible Exile braids this hugely successful writer's ordeal of dispossession and homelessness after 1934 with the trajectory of Prochnik's own family - like Zweig's, Viennese Jews who moved to the Americas. He also travels in his subject's footsteps and crafts aphorism-studded reflections on his work, life and times. If such a hybrid genre presents pitfalls for the writer, it can also deliver rich rewards. Rebecca Mead, for one, reaped them in her fine book about a lifetime's journey with George Eliot, The Road to Middlemarch. If this equally subtle blend invites that comparison, it may not be pure coincidence. George Prochnik and Rebecca Mead are husband and wife. .. Prochnik can pay homage to this big-hearted, hyper-active visionary with a 'genius for friendship' without making him the equal in exile of Thomas Mann or Sigmund Freud - whose eulogy Zweig delivered at Golders Green cemetery in 1939.Typically, it fell to Zweig - the ultimate networker and stalwart volunteer - to do the job. Up the road in Hampstead, Prochnik speaks with Lotte's niece Eva, who as a child lived with the couple. Now in her eighties, Eva can look back on a long, rich career in the health service and as a mentor for young musicians. Despairing solitude snuffed out Zweig's own hopes. Yet his books endure - re-translated recently to loud acclaim - while those he nurtured would heal a wounded world. Through the lives and minds of others, the exile rebuilt his home." - Boyd Tonkin

NY: Other Press, 2014. Purple boards with white titled spine, dust jacket. 390 pages, some text photos. "By the 1930s, Stefan Zweig had become the most widely translated living author in the world. His novels, short stories, and biographies were so compelling that they became instant best sellers. Zweig was also an intellectual and a lover of all the arts, high and low. Yet after Hitler’s rise to power, this celebrated writer who had dedicated so much energy to promoting international humanism plummeted, in a matter of a few years, into an increasingly isolated exile—from London to Bath to New York City, then Ossining, Rio, and finally Petrópolis—where, in 1942, in a cramped bungalow, he killed himself. The Impossible Exile tells the tragic story of Zweig’s extraordinary rise and fall while it also depicts, with great acumen, the gulf between the world of ideas in Europe and in America, and the consuming struggle of those forced to forsake one for the other. It also reveals how Zweig embodied, through his work, thoughts, and behavior, the end of an era-the implosion of Europe as an ideal of Western civilization.". Hard Cover. Very Good/Very Good.
